Call from Advanced Training: ANDROS


[Photo from October '08]
Well I just got my call from Gwen. She said he knows all his commands and can do them very, very well. He requires minimal cues and encouragement from his trainer. She also raved about how wonderful of a dog he is, very sweet and loving. She also said he is her most finished dog. She also talked about how when some prospective applicants came and worked dogs, they used Andros and he was a wonderful example of what an assistance dog should look like!

Now onto the not so good news.....
While he is doing great! He also anticipates commands, and is a sensitive dog, so his prospective placement is as a Skilled Companion. This part is great! I always thought he'd make a great Skilled Companion! The incoming TT class has 7 people in it, and 11 dogs will be rotating through. So 4 dogs will not be graduating in this class. There are 5 people needing SD, and only 2 people needing SC. Gwen says she does not know at all, whether Andros will be graduating this class. But she says that unless he decides to bite someone she has no doubt that he will graduate at sometime!(Prolly February) I So hopefully my boy will make a match, but I know CCI knows best, and will find him a perfect person :)

I have been told that CCI never tells you that your dog will definitely make a match, so I shall be waiting until next Tuesday, when I will be receiving another call telling me whether he has made a "Pre-match". So until then, everyone cross your finger and your paws for Mr. Andros.

What's the relevance of today you might ask......


and I shall answer that for you. Today's date in October 14, 2009. That means that in 1 MONTH if Andros II makes a match he will be graduating!!!!!!!! YIPPEE!! I'm so thrilled, so to celebrate this momentous occasion I am going to give ya some cutie pictures of Andi man and explain to you what shall be happening with CCI and *hopefully* Andros in the next month!

In 2 weeks, on the 28th. I am going to get a call from Gwen, Andros's trainer. She is going to discuss his potential in the upcoming Team Training Class. So for the next two weeks Andi is gonna be working on his skills so hopefully he can be placed! Then on November 2nd, the team training class comes in. They will begin working with the dogs, and I think on the 3rd or 4th is when you know if your dog has made a match. So Gwen will give me a call and let me know that! If he does make a match him and his partner will spend the next two weeks working and learning how to be a team with CCI's instruction. If all is a "GO" My family and I shall be coming to Delaware, OH on the 13th. On the 14th is the ceremony, where I get to ceremonially "hand over" Andros's leash!!! Also that morning I get to have breakfast with his grad and get some "andi and I" time!!! I'm so excited, but I always have to keep in the back of my head......that it's not for sure yet.......
